Hi All,
 
I've got a strange problem when I try do delete old filespaces. The
scenario:
 
I've made a backup of the old 5.1.1.0 database. On the new system I
installed TSM 5.2.6.3 on the new system and restored the database there.
So far so good.
To start freshly on all clients we decided to delete all the old
filespaces and than this:
 
 
11/10/05 13:48:55     ANR2017I Administrator ADMIN issued command:
DELETE       
                       FILESPACE lima 1 t=any data=any namet=fsid
wait=no       
                       (SESSION: 2669)

11/10/05 13:48:55     ANR0984I Process 63 for DELETE FILESPACE started
in the   
                       BACKGROUND at 13:48:55. (SESSION: 2669, PROCESS:
63)     
11/10/05 13:48:55     ANR0800I DELETE FILESPACE / (fsId=1) for node LIMA
started
                       as process 63. (SESSION: 2669, PROCESS: 63)

11/10/05 13:48:55     ANR0802I DELETE FILESPACE / (fsId=1)
(backup/archive data)
                       for node LIMA started. (SESSION: 2669, PROCESS:
63)
